Job Summary

Giesecke+Devrient (G+D) is currently seeking a skilled Machine Operator to join our EMV department at our Bolingbrook manufacturing facility. This is a third-shift position working Monday through Friday from 11:00 p.m. to 7:00 a.m. with regular opportunities for overtime. We are looking for a positive and experienced individual eager for a long-term role, who thrives on physical work, enjoys guiding staff, and is committed to achieving results. As the role evolves, the successful candidate will take on new responsibilities and challenges.

 

Key Responsibilities:

  • Operate EMV machines during production, ensuring products are manufactured within established parameters.
  • Understand and execute the entire range of machine functions and operating sequences.
  • Load materials onto machines in the required order and sequence.
  • Read job specifications and previous run data to set machine parameters and material requirements.
  • Perform maintenance following proper Lockout/Tag-out procedures.
  • Meet or exceed job standards for line speeds, scrap rates, and setup times.
  • Load and unload stock efficiently and safely.
  • Maintain department inventory and supplies, ensuring everything is accounted for.
  • Report any maintenance needs to the Maintenance Department promptly.
  • Collaborate with the Quality Assurance department to ensure product specifications are met.
  • Complete all required documentation and data entry accurately and in a timely manner.
  • Engage in ongoing training opportunities to support a continuous quality improvement environment.
  • Verify material conformance to specifications using measuring devices such as micrometers, tape measures, and calipers.
  • Maintain cleanliness of the work area and equipment, ensuring a safe and organized workspace.
  • Verify that guards at pinch points and potential burn areas are present before operating the machine.
  • Conduct thorough inspections to ensure the highest quality standards.
  • Adhere to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) policies and procedures, taking immediate action to correct safety and security issues.
  • Ensure the operation of equipment by completing preventive maintenance requirements, following manufacturer’s instructions, and troubleshooting malfunctions when necessary.
